According to God’s holy promise, the saints of Christ will dine at the marriage supper of the Lamb, a feast of love and communion with the risen Lord and Savior himself. The Feast of Christ the King, the last Sunday before Advent, anticipates the day when Christ will reign supreme, and the saints of God will never again leave the presence of their Lord.

THIS WEEK’S THEME The Lord Reigns, Psalm 93

The Lord reigns. This is not merely a statement of current events, but an abiding and unchanging truth. He has reigned from before time. Before there was time, God was king. He reigns over all his creation, both now and forever. He is mightier than even the raw unbridled power of the ocean. He has promised to restore all things, and he is trustworthy. He has both the power and the love to fulfill his promise. Truly, he is holy and he reigns forever.

Invocation: Our Prayer of Acclamation O thouwho art the hope of theworld, hasten, we beseech thee, the coming of thy kingdomupon earth. Establish thy rulewithin us; enter into our minds with thy truth and dwell in our hearts with thy righteousness and compassion. Establish thy rule in our midst; enter into our homes, our schools and churches, our industry and commerce, all our cities and countries, that theworldmay be turned from the paths of destruction toward the shining city of God; through Jesus Christ our Lord. Amen.

~ Ernest Fremont Tittle (Tittle, p. 84)
